Episode 1:The Courage to Be
The Courage To BE…. Who AM I? Am I Brave? Am I Beautiful? Am I Enough? Am I ever going to lose those last 10lbs? As women, we continuously question our I AM and often find it challenging to embrace our BEING. We often put our trauma and pain on the shelf and abandon our mental wellness for the sake of the misguided programming of our youth that taught us that honoring our strength made us boastful and sacred self-care was selfish. When we are very young, each of us is programmed with beliefs about our worth, potential, and identity. These beliefs form our self-image. Our self-image is simply the image we hold of ourselves. If we view ourselves highly and healthily, we're more likely to believe we can be, do, and have more in our lives. And consequently, those beliefs translate into our actions. And our results. In other words, people who have a healthy self-image end up being, doing, and having more in their lives. On the other hand, if we have a low view of ourselves, we might think of ourselves as simply victims of our circumstances. So, here we are, looking outside of ourselves for the answers that are found within. So, here we are, looking for the Courage to BE, the best version of ourselves. So here we are, wondering HOW to make the SHIFT … Let's Talk.

Hello Heffa, Goodbye
You cannot rise above the image you have for yourself. Your image is controlled by a mental blueprint we have inside our subconscious mind, and it dictates WHERE we think we belong. I call my subconscious voice “Heffa”, do you have a name for yours? The Heffa has saved me from making a few horrible decision, like not going on a 2nd date with the creep who wanted to date my breast not me. But she has also interfered with me pursuing my dreams; She whispers things like “ WHO do you think you are?” “ARE you sure you can do that by yourself?” oh, the best one yet is “Remember the last time you tried that and failed.” She doesn’t stop. She is always talking to me so I had learned to TALK BACK to HER. What I did was make the unconscious conscious and fight HEFFA on my territory; the conscious now. Have I always done things right — NO — will I spend the rest of my life ruminating about things I cannot change - NO - Can I script a new narrative aligned to WHO I AM NOW — absolutely! Owning your I AM story is the key to creating a positive self- image. We are all on the same journey although we may take different paths. I have some questions Where are you now? Think about what is working for you and what isn’t .. what is pleasing, what is frustrating .. different areas of your life .. where can you grow .. where are you doing well .. are you doing your best .. what’s your biggest challenge right now .. what’s your biggest asset right now? Think about all the reasons for your successes and failures. Where are you stuck .. why are you stuck? Where did you win .. why did you win? Where are you stagnating .. why are you stagnating? Where you happy .. why are you happy? Where are you hurting .. why are you hurting? Where do you have hope .. why do you have hope? Where do you feel hopeless .. why do you feel hopeless?
